Re: W/C J.E.Zumbach
There are several stories (as usual with Zumbach) covering the same incident. It seems he flew an Auster with another pilot as passenger from Gilze Rijen to Eindhoven. They were a little bit drunk and got lost, so landed in field to wait to th next morning. They were taken PoW and send to a camp on an Dutch island. According to one version, the landing place was close to HQ of Blaskowitz, who met them personally, but could you believe it?
